Where to stay in Desert View Village

Downtown Phoenix
Known for its ample dining options and great live music, there's plenty to explore in Downtown Phoenix. You can visit top attractions like Chase Field and Mortgage Matchup Center, and jump on the metro at 12th Street - Jefferson Station or 12th Street - Washington Station to see more of the city.

Rio Verde Foothills
If you're looking for some top things to see and do in Rio Verde Foothills and surrounding area, you can visit Tom's Thumb Trail and Tonto Verde Golf Club.

Old Town
Gourmet restaurants interesting history and top sights from Scottsdale Waterfront to Western Spirit: Scottsdale's Museum of the West – discover Old Town, a destination also famous for its shopping.

Camelback East
You might take some time to check out the abundant dining options in Camelback East. Spend some time visiting top spots like Biltmore Fashion Park, and catch the metro at 44th Street - Washington Station or 50th Street Station to see more of the area.
